Inter and Napoli target Stanislav Lobotka says “we’ll see what happens in January”, and confirms he wants to play in the Champions League.

Both Serie A sides, along with Paris Saint-Germain and Barcelona, were linked with the Slovakian midfielder in the summer, but he ultimately decided to stay with Celta Vigo.

“Yes, in the summer there were offers from different clubs, but I’ll play with Celta at least for half the season,” Lobotka told Marca.

“It’s clear that all Celta players want to try and adventure with one of the bigger clubs in Europe. In football, everyone wants to play in the Champions League.

“I’m focused on doing well with Celta, then we’ll see what happens in January.”

Lobotka’s release clause is believed to be around €42m, but Champions League progression could provide Inter or Napoli with the funds to activate it.
